6

常见分布式系统设计图解(汇总)

 3 years ago
source link: https://www.raychase.net/6364
Go to the source link to view the article. You can view the picture content, updated content and better typesetting reading experience. If the link is broken, please click the button below to view the snapshot at that time.
neoserver,ios ssh client

常见分布式系统设计图解(汇总)

这一篇是给我记录的那些常见分布式系统设计图解系列的文章做一个汇总,也提供一个访问入口。

soothing-sound-system.jpg

如同我在第一篇文中说的那样,自己在学习各种各样分布式系统的过程中,做了一些笔记,也有自己的理解,把它们放到一起,用一张图选择最主要的部分来阐释,从我的角度来说,是能够帮助理解和记忆的。事实上,遇到的很多各种各样的分布式系统,绝大多数都逃不出那最常见的十几种,也就是说,逃不出这些 “套路” 和 “玩法”。这就是把它们整理成一个系列的初衷。

我的想法是,这些文章大致分为两个部分,第一部分是偏重应用的分布式系统,第二部分是偏重基础设施的分布式系统。每一部分的列表是可能继续增长的,我会把它们维护在这里。

应用部分:

基础设施部分:

此外,还有一些系统在我看来是经典的,但是却没有记录在此:

  • “相对” 简单一些的系统,应用系统包括短 URL 系统,基础设施系统包括分布式缓存;
  • 很多核心要素上面都已经包括了的系统,再单独拿出来缺少特异性,比如一些图片分享系统;
  • 还有一些系统,使用组件分布伴随控制流和数据流的图示来描述它的核心内容,我觉得是不合适的,如分布式锁。

文章未经特殊标明皆为本人原创,未经许可不得用于任何商业用途,转载请保持完整性并注明来源链接 《四火的唠叨》

Posted in Recommended, System and ArchitectureTagged 分布式系统, 图解笔记, 基础设施, 应用系统, 系统设计 1,170 次阅读

Leave a Reply Cancel reply

Your email address will not be published.

Comment

Name

Email

Website

Save my name, email, and website in this browser for the next time I comment.


About Joyk


Aggregate valuable and interesting links.
Joyk means Joy of geeK